India, the world's most populous country, is
grappling with the significant challenge of a majority of
its population residing in rural areas. To tackle this issue,
the Ministry of Rural Development, Government of
India has implemented the National Rural Livelihood
Mission (NRLM).This paper is an attempt to surface
critical challenges faced by SHGs, possible solutions, and
government efforts to address these challenges. Direct
interaction with women of SHGs is done with the focused
group method in the Ghaziabad district of Uttar
Pradesh, further solutions for these critical difficulties
are developed with the interaction of Government
officials and other experts.We have clustered the critical
factors affecting women's participation. Experts’
solutions and governmental action to take care of these
issues are also identified and reported in the paper. The
research is unique as it not only identifies the problems
but suggests possible solutions for the issue. Research
implications are wide, it can be taken as an ignition to a
series of such researches, and more important is to
develop solution strategies in advance.
